In 2026, Grad Nite serves as a high-stakes "rite of passage" for graduating high school seniors, providing a safe, supervised, and exclusive environment to celebrate their academic milestone. At major theme parks like Disneyland and Universal Studios, the primary purpose is to offer an "after-hours" party where the parks are closed to the general public, allowing students to enjoy attractions, dance parties with live DJs, and special "grad-only" photo opportunities without the usual crowds. For schools and parents, the event is designed as a sober alternative to traditional unmonitored parties, minimizing risks associated with underage drinking and reckless driving. By 2026, these events have evolved into multi-tiered ticketed experiences, sometimes spanning an entire day of park access followed by a private midnight bash, reinforcing a sense of community and shared accomplishment among classmates before they disperse for college or careers.
